Integrated adsorption desulphurisation system for low-temperature moving bed

摘要

Integrated adsorption-desulphurisation-desulphurisation system for low temperature moving bed, comprising an introduction line for SO2 and NOx containing flue gas, a flue-gas suction blower (1), a flue-gas recovery apparatus (2), a flue-gas cooling system (3), a low temperature moving bed adsorption tower (4), a refrigeration recovery apparatus (6) and a desorption tower (5);where the intake pipe for SO2 and NOx containing flue-gas through the flue-gas intake blower (1) is connected to an inlet of the flue-gas heat recovery device (2), an outlet of the flue-gas recovery device (2) is connected to an inlet of the flue-gas cooling system (3), where an exhaust outlet of the flue-gas cooling system (3) is connected to a flue-gas inlet of the low-temperature moving bed adsorption tower (4), with a porous adsorption outlet at the bottom of the low-temperature moving bed adsorption tower (4) connected to an inlet of the desorption tower (5),where a pore adsorption tower outlet (5) is connected to a pore adsorption outlet at the top of the low temperature bed adsorption tower (4), a gas outlet of the low temperature bed adsorption tower (4) is connected to the outlet of the cold recovery apparatus (6); andwhere the flue gas cooling system (3) uses a three-stage type spray cooling structure.
